I had one that was sold at JC Penny's in my truck when I bought it. I was told it worked, but it looked like crap and took up a lot of leg room. One of the first things I did was rip it all out.

There was a York compressor on the passenger side and an added pully on the crank to run it. There was also a seperate cooler mounted in front of the radiator and 2 hoses that ran into the cab.

If your truck is an original A/C truck, I would stick to that and maybe just replace the broken parts. It looks a lot better and doesn't take up the sort of space as the under dash setup did.
